Tips for Unlocking the Benefits of Developmental Rotations to Grow Talent from Within
Introduction A developmental rotation is a structured program allowing employees to temporarily transfer to different roles, workstreams, or departments within an organization. Organizations can use developmental rotations as a tool for developing and engaging employees and increasing organizational agility. All About FMP’s Internship Program
What kind of interns does FMP hire? FMP hires Human Capital interns each summer. Most often, these interns are partially through graduate school and are seeking work experience as part of their graduate program.
